
如何查询微信支付API密钥:登录微信支付商户平台、进入API安全设置、查看并复制API密钥。其中,登录微信支付商户平台是第一步,确保你有正确的账户权限。然后,找到API安全设置是关键步骤,很多用户会在此遇到问题。最后,查看并复制API密钥是最重要的步骤,因为这决定了你能否成功进行API操作。
一、登录微信支付商户平台
在查询微信支付API密钥之前,首先需要登录微信支付商户平台。微信支付商户平台是微信支付提供给商户管理支付业务的后台系统,登录过程如下:
- 打开微信支付商户平台网站:在浏览器中输入微信支付商户平台的网址(https://pay.weixin.qq.com/),进入登录页面。
- 输入商户号和密码:在登录页面上输入你的商户号和密码。如果你是第一次登录,可能需要按照提示进行一些安全设置。
- 完成验证:根据系统提示,完成手机验证码或其他方式的验证,以确保账户的安全。
二、进入API安全设置
成功登录后,你需要找到API安全设置的位置。这个步骤对于很多用户来说可能有点复杂,因为商户平台的功能很多,导航也比较多样。具体步骤如下:
- 找到“账户中心”:在商户平台的主界面上,你会看到一个名为“账户中心”的选项,点击进入。
- 选择“API安全”:在“账户中心”页面中,找到并点击“API安全”选项。这是查询和管理API密钥的地方。
三、查看并复制API密钥
进入API安全设置页面后,你就可以查看并复制API密钥。具体操作如下:
- 查看API密钥:在API安全设置页面,你会看到一个名为“API密钥”的选项。点击它,系统会提示你输入商户平台的登录密码进行验证。
- 输入登录密码:根据提示,输入你在登录商户平台时使用的密码。这一步是为了确保只有授权用户才能查看API密钥。
- 复制API密钥:验证通过后,系统会显示你的API密钥。你可以直接复制这个密钥,用于后续的API操作。
四、API密钥的使用和安全
在获得API密钥后,你需要确保它的安全和正确使用。以下是一些使用和安全注意事项:
- 安全存储:API密钥是非常敏感的信息,必须妥善保管。不要将其存储在不安全的地方,如明文文件或未经加密的数据库中。
- 定期更换:为确保安全,建议定期更换API密钥,并更新所有使用该密钥的应用。
- 权限管理:确保只有授权人员才能访问API密钥,避免因密钥泄露导致的安全问题。
五、常见问题和解决方法
在查询和使用微信支付API密钥的过程中,可能会遇到一些常见问题。以下是一些常见问题及其解决方法:
- 忘记商户号或密码:如果你忘记了商户号或密码,可以通过微信支付商户平台的找回功能进行找回。通常需要提供注册时使用的邮箱或手机号。
- 无法进入API安全设置:如果你无法进入API安全设置页面,可能是因为你的账户权限不足。请联系账户管理员或微信支付客服进行处理。
- API密钥失效:如果API密钥失效,可能是因为密钥被重置或过期。请重新生成并更新密钥。
六、使用API密钥进行开发
获得API密钥后,你可以开始进行微信支付相关的开发工作。以下是一些常见的API操作及其使用方法:
- 支付接口:使用API密钥可以调用微信支付的各类支付接口,如统一下单接口、查询订单接口等。每个接口的具体使用方法可以参考微信支付的开发文档。
- 退款接口:在需要进行退款操作时,可以使用API密钥调用微信支付的退款接口。需要注意的是,退款操作需要进行双重验证,以确保资金安全。
- 通知接口:微信支付提供了各种通知接口,如支付成功通知、退款成功通知等。开发者可以使用API密钥设置这些通知接口,以便在支付状态发生变化时及时获得通知。
七、API密钥的管理和维护
在使用API密钥进行开发的过程中,良好的管理和维护是确保系统安全和稳定运行的关键。以下是一些管理和维护的建议:
- 定期审计:定期审计API密钥的使用情况,确保没有未经授权的访问和操作。
- 日志记录:记录所有使用API密钥的操作日志,以便在出现问题时进行追踪和分析。
- 安全培训:对开发和运维人员进行安全培训,提高他们对API密钥安全使用的意识。
八、API密钥的更新和替换
在系统运行过程中,可能会需要更新和替换API密钥。以下是一些更新和替换API密钥的建议:
- 提前通知:在更新和替换API密钥之前,提前通知所有相关人员和系统,以便他们做好准备。
- 逐步替换:在更新和替换API密钥时,建议逐步进行,以避免因密钥更换导致的系统故障。
- 测试验证:在更新和替换API密钥后,进行充分的测试和验证,确保新密钥能够正常使用。
九、API密钥的应急处理
在使用API密钥的过程中,可能会遇到一些突发情况需要紧急处理。以下是一些应急处理的建议:
- 密钥泄露:如果发现API密钥泄露,立即更换密钥,并通知所有相关系统和人员进行更新。
- 系统故障:如果因API密钥问题导致系统故障,立即进行排查和修复,并在必要时联系微信支付客服寻求帮助。
- 数据丢失:如果因API密钥问题导致数据丢失,尽快进行数据恢复,并采取措施防止类似问题再次发生。
十、总结
查询微信支付API密钥是进行微信支付开发的第一步,也是非常重要的一步。通过登录微信支付商户平台,进入API安全设置页面,查看并复制API密钥,开发者可以获得进行微信支付相关开发所需的关键信息。同时,在使用API密钥的过程中,必须高度重视安全管理,确保密钥的安全存储、定期更换、权限管理等,避免因密钥泄露或滥用导致的安全问题。通过良好的管理和维护,开发者可以确保系统的安全和稳定运行,实现微信支付的各类功能。
相关问答FAQs:
1. 为什么我需要查询微信支付API密钥?
查询微信支付API密钥是为了确保您的支付系统能够与微信支付平台正常交互,保障支付数据的安全性和准确性。
2. 如何查询微信支付API密钥?
要查询微信支付API密钥,您需要登录到微信支付商户平台,并按照以下步骤操作:
- 在左侧导航栏中找到“账户中心”选项,点击进入。
- 在“账户中心”页面中,找到“API安全”选项,点击进入。
- 在“API安全”页面中,您可以找到和管理您的API密钥。如果您还没有生成API密钥,可以点击“生成API密钥”按钮进行创建。
3. 如何保护我的微信支付API密钥的安全性?
为了保护您的微信支付API密钥的安全性,您可以采取以下措施:
- 不要将API密钥存储在公共的代码库或版本控制系统中。
- 不要将API密钥直接暴露在公共网络中,可以通过加密或其他安全手段来保护传输过程中的密钥。
- 定期更换API密钥,建议每隔一段时间更新一次密钥,以提高系统的安全性。
- 对于有权限访问API密钥的人员,要进行身份验证和权限管理,确保只有授权人员能够使用和管理API密钥。
请注意,以上是一般的操作指南,具体查询微信支付API密钥的步骤可能因微信支付平台的更新而有所变化,建议您参考微信支付官方文档或联系微信支付客服获取最新的操作指引。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3281139